Bulbs – cover
The larger cover has to be removed in order
to change the high/low beam headlight bulbs.
Removing the cover to access the bulbs
NOTE
Before starting to replace a bulb, see
Bulbs – introduction (p. 327).
1. Loosen the cover's four retaining screws
(3-4 turns) with a Torx T20 tool (1). The
screws should not be removed com-
pletely.
2. Push the cover to the side.
3. Remove the cover.
Reinstall the cover in the reverse order.
